Background technology
In CDN (Content Delivery Network, content distributing network), scheduling is a kind of important technology. Scheduling refers to that the service request by each user is assigned in corresponding server, to meet the demand for services of each user, and it is real Existing server load balancing.
In video traffic, generally use is based on http (Hyper Text Transfer Protocol, Hyper text transfer Agreement) the schedulers that redirects of 302 conditional codes be scheduled.Scheduler is typically negative from realization server when being scheduled Balanced angle is carried to be scheduled.For example, scheduler is usually by current Video service request scheduling to the minimum service of load In device.
However, inventor has found in the implementation of the present invention, at least there are the following problems for the prior art:
In video traffic, there are the users that malicious access (such as brush amount steals chain) or network are poor.In this case, Using existing video dispatching method, the preferable server of service quality (may be properly termed as good service device, interim card Ratio and ratio is smaller at a slow speed) distribute to malicious access or the poor user of network, this will lead to the waste of Service Source.

Optionally, as a kind of embodiment of the embodiment of the present invention, the calculating of the current service weighted value of each client Process can be with as shown in Fig. 2, include the following steps:
S210:According to each client video account login times within a preset period of time and/or watch time of video Length determines the safe credit value of each client.
In embodiments of the present invention, scheduler can count the video account login time and login times of each client, And the time of viewing video.Scheduler can according to the video account login times of each client within a preset period of time and/ Or the time length of viewing video, determine the safe credit value of each client.For example, scheduler is every the primary visitor of 8 hours statistics The time length of the video account login times and viewing video at family end, if some client during this period of time logs in video The number of account is more than preset first threshold, and the time for watching video is less than preset second threshold, then by the client The safe credit value at end is arranged to lower value.The safe credit value range of each client can be arranged to 0~100 point, score value It is higher that represent safe credit worthiness higher.
S220:The speed of download for downloading each video file within a preset period of time according to each client determines each client Service quality value.
Scheduler can count the speed of download of primary each each video file of client downloads every the preset period, Then using the median of the speed of download of each client or average value as the standard download speed of each client, if standard Speed of download value is bigger, then the service quality value of the client is higher.The range of the service quality value of client can also be arranged At 0~100 point.
S230:According to the safe credit value of each client, the service quality value of each client and preset service weighted value Calculation formula determines the service weighted value of each client.
In view of practical application request, the embodiment of the present invention is wished when safe credit value is relatively low, with safe credit value Increase, service weighted value can obviously increase;When safe credit value is higher, with the increase of safe credit value, service adds The increased unobvious of weights, only service quality value increase can just so that servicing weighted value increases at this time.Therefore, if by client The service weighted value at end is expressed as Sw, safe credit value is expressed as Sr, service quality value is expressed as Sq, then following public affairs can be used Formula calculates Sw
Sw=a*Sq*ln(b*Sr+1)
Wherein, a, b are preset coefficient.
In scheme provided in an embodiment of the present invention, when calculating the service weighted value of client, client has been considered Safe credit value and service quality value, enable the service weighted value of client embody simultaneously client safe prestige and under Carry speed.
Optionally, as a kind of embodiment of the embodiment of the present invention, above-mentioned steps S220 can be with as shown in figure 3, include Following steps:
S221:Obtain the speed of download that each client downloads each video file within a preset period of time.
Scheduler can obtain the daily record of each each video file of client downloads in preset time period, then from these daily records The middle speed for obtaining each downloading video files.
S222:Using the median of the speed of download of each client as the standard download speed of each client.
The speed of download of each client can be ranked up by scheduler respectively, then chosen median therein respectively and made For the standard download speed of each client.
S223:The standard download speed of each client is ranked up according to sequence from small to large, by any client Sequence serial number and each client sum ratio, the service quality value as any client.
The standard download speed of each client can be ranked up by scheduler according to sequence from small to large, then will be appointed The ratio of the sequence serial number and each client sum of one client, the service quality value as any client.When using percentage When processed, data are obtained after can the ratio of the sequence serial number of arbitrary client and each client sum being multiplied by 100, as any The service quality value of client.For example, a total of 10 clients, the service quality value for being arranged in the 6th client can be with It is denoted as:6/10*100=60.If computational accuracy is of less demanding, when it is decimal service quality point occur, decimal can be taken Service quality value of the integer obtained after whole as client.Wherein, " * " in the embodiment indicates the multiplication between numerical value.
As shown in figure 4, being a kind of statistics of client secure credit value and service quality value provided in an embodiment of the present invention Table can include the safe credit value and service quality value of the IP address and client of client in the table.For example, statistics The second row indicates that the safe credit value for the client that IP address is 202.111.111.11 is 96 points in table, service quality value 88 Point.
In scheme provided in an embodiment of the present invention, when determining service quality value, by the middle position of the speed of download of client It is worth the standard download speed as client, the service quality value obtained in this way can more represent the service quality of the client.
Optionally, as a kind of embodiment of the embodiment of the present invention, the determination process for servicing Weighted Threshold can be such as Fig. 5 It is shown, include the following steps:
S510:The service weighted value of each client is ranked up according to sequence from big to small.
The service weighted value of each client can be ranked up by scheduler according to sequence from big to small.
S520:According to sequence as a result, and preset good service device and common server quantity ratio, determine clothes Business Weighted Threshold.
For example, preset good service device:Preset common server=3:1, scheduler can will be arranged in 30% The service weighted value set is as service Weighted Threshold.Variation or preset good service device due to client sum with it is common The variation of the quantity ratio of server causes preset good service device with the quantity ratio of common server without directly corresponding Service weighted value when, service Weighted Threshold can be determined by way of rounding.For example, the sum when client is 12 When, due to 12*30%=3.6, at this moment the service weighted value for being arranged in the 4th can be added as service by way of rounding Weigh threshold value.
In scheme provided in an embodiment of the present invention, when calculating service weighted value, the service of each client has been considered The quantity ratio of weighted value and preset good service device and common server, the service Weighted Threshold calculated in this way can be equal It weighs the load of each server.
Optionally, as shown in fig. 6, a kind of embodiment as the embodiment of the present invention, scheduler carried out S110 it Afterwards, following steps be can also carry out:
S1101:Obtain the integrated service weighted value and integrated service Weighted Threshold of client.
Wherein, integrated service weighted value services weighted value according to the preset number of client and is calculated, integrated service Weighted Threshold is according to the quantity ratio of the integrated service weighted value and preset good service device and common server of each client It is calculated.
In embodiments of the present invention, scheduler can calculate the service weighted value of multiple periods, then according to preset Integrated service weighted value calculation formula obtains integrated service Weighted Threshold.For example, scheduler can be primary each every calculating in 10 seconds Client go over 5 minutes, past 30 seconds, past 10 seconds when service weighted value, the calculation formula of integrated service weighted value can be with It is expressed as:
Sc=d*S5m+e*S30s+f*S10s
Wherein, ScIndicate integrated service weighted value, S5m、S30s、S10sPast 5 minutes, past 30 seconds, past 10 are indicated respectively Second when service weighted value, d, e, f are predetermined coefficient, and d+e+f=1.
It, can be by these integrated services after the integrated service weighted value for determining each client by calculation formula above Weighted value sorts from big to small, arrangement position is equal to or closest to default good service device and default common server quantity ratio The integrated service weighted value of value is as integrated service Weighted Threshold.
S1102:Using the integrated service weighted value of the client service weighted value current as client, by integrated service plus Threshold value is weighed as current service Weighted Threshold.
Integrated service can be weighted threshold by the integrated service weighted value service weighted value current as client by scheduler Then value executes step S130 as current service Weighted Threshold.
In scheme provided in an embodiment of the present invention, using corresponding integrated service weighted value of multiple periods as current clothes Business weighted value, the current service weighted value obtained in this way can more reflect the safe credit value and service quality value of client, with true Protect the rational management of server resource.
Optionally, as a kind of embodiment of the embodiment of the present invention, scheduler can also carry out after having carried out S110 Following steps:
S11001:Judge whether client is included in the scoring list being generated in advance, each client in list of scoring The total degree for accessing each video server is all higher than preset amount threshold.If so, executing S11002;If not, executing S11003。
Scheduler can count the number that client accesses each video server, and access times are more than preset quantity threshold It is worth corresponding client to be added in scoring list.It, can after scheduler receives the Video service request of client transmission First to judge the client whether in list of scoring.
S11002:Obtain the current service weighted value of client and current service Weighted Threshold.
S11003:According to the preset algorithm (for example, minimum join algorithm or Weighted Round Robin) for realizing load balancing, Client is dispatched to and loads smaller server.
In scheme provided in an embodiment of the present invention, it is contemplated that some clients access the total degree of each video server too It is few, cause the service weighted value that scheduler calculates that may not be able to represent client really safe credit value and service quality value. In this case, if using video dispatching method as shown in Figure 1, practical significance is little, is respectively regarded so being accessed in scheduling When the total degree of frequency server is less than the client of preset amount threshold, directly using realization load balancing in the prior art Algorithm is scheduled, rationally to utilize scheduler.
